 Sedum clavatum – The Rosette Beauty You’ll Love to Grow

Sedum clavatum is a stunning, fast-growing succulent known for its tight rosettes of powdery blue-green leaves that blush with pink edges under bright sunlight. Native to Mexico, this low-maintenance beauty is perfect for pots, succulent arrangements, and cascading over garden beds or hanging baskets.

Features:

  • Eye-Catching Rosettes: Plump, rounded leaves form neat clusters that grow beautifully over time.

  • Sun-Kissed Colour: Leaves develop soft pink tips in bright light or cool weather.

  • Spreading Growth: Creates a lush, trailing effect ideal for edges, rock gardens, or indoor pots.

  • Drought Tolerant: Requires very little water once established.

  • Easy to Propagate: Grows quickly from cuttings and leaf drops.

🪴 Care Tips:

  • Light: Prefers full sun to partial shade. Morning sun brings out best colours.

  • Water: Water deeply but infrequently – only when soil is completely dry.

  • Soil: Well-draining succulent or cactus mix.

  • Climate: Best suited for warm climates; protect from heavy frost.

Whether you're designing a succulent bowl or filling gaps in a sunny garden bed, Sedum clavatum is a resilient and beautiful choice that delivers colour and charm all year round.
